Bonjour,
j'ai un script batch, qui me permet de généré une requete et créer un fichier excel, vers un dossier spécifique, cependant j'ai un petit soucis au niveau de l'affichage, voici ma requete :

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
select
identifiant as NUMERO
from table1 t1
inner join ......
inner join aisx_person_fj t4 on t3.x520_formjur=t4.x521_code
left.......
where .....
and ....... and rownum<10
order by identifiant ;
jusque là tout va bien, il génère bien mon fichier excel, dans l'invite de commande il montre ma liste des identifiants :
0000111
00033333
000999
000888

mais dans mon fichier excel il le met de la façon suivant :
111
33333
999
888

or moi j'ai besoin des 0 au début . j'ai essayé un cast(identifiant as varchar(10) as identifiant, rien n'y fait ou un to_char idem , comment je peux faire pour afficher mes 0000 dans mon fichier excel ? Petite précision mon fichier excel est au format csv et je ne peux pas changer le format

P.s : quand je génère la requete via sqldeveloper et que j'exporte au format xlsx ça marche

Un grand merci à vous